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[locale] Fix Arabic locale for months (again) #4359

Merged
merged 3 commits into from Dec 19, 2017
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Jump to
Jump to file
Failed to load files.
Diff view
Diff view
24 changes: 12 additions & 12 deletions src/locale/ar.js
Expand Up @@ -47,18 +47,18 @@ var symbolMap = {
return str.replace(/%d/i, number);
};
}, months = [
'كانون الثاني يناير',
'شباط فبراير',
'آذار مارس',
'نيسان أبريل',
'أيار مايو',
'حزيران يونيو',
'تموز يوليو',
'آب أغسطس',
'أيلول سبتمبر',
'تشرين الأول أكتوبر',
'تشرين الثاني نوفمبر',
'كانون الأول ديسمبر'
'يناير',
'فبراير',
'مارس',
'أبريل',
'مايو',
'يونيو',
'يوليو',
'أغسطس',
'سبتمبر',
'أكتوبر',
'نوفمبر',
'ديسمبر'
];

export default moment.defineLocale('ar', {
Expand Down
40 changes: 20 additions & 20 deletions src/test/locale/ar.js
Expand Up @@ -3,18 +3,18 @@ import moment from '../../moment';
localeModule('ar');

var months = [
'كانون الثاني يناير',
'شباط فبراير',
'آذار مارس',
'نيسان أبريل',
'أيار مايو',
'حزيران يونيو',
'تموز يوليو',
'آب أغسطس',
'أيلول سبتمبر',
'تشرين الأول أكتوبر',
'تشرين الثاني نوفمبر',
'كانون الأول ديسمبر'
'يناير',
'فبراير',
'مارس',
'أبريل',
'مايو',
'يونيو',
'يوليو',
'أغسطس',
'سبتمبر',
'أكتوبر',
'نوفمبر',
'ديسمبر'
];

test('parse', function (assert) {
Expand All @@ -36,9 +36,9 @@ test('parse', function (assert) {

test('format', function (assert) {
var a = [
['dddd, MMMM Do YYYY, h:mm:ss a', 'الأحد، شباط فبراير ١٤ ٢٠١٠، ٣:٢٥:٥٠ م'],
['dddd, MMMM Do YYYY, h:mm:ss a', 'الأحد، فبراير ١٤ ٢٠١٠، ٣:٢٥:٥٠ م'],
['ddd, hA', 'أحد، ٣م'],
['M Mo MM MMMM MMM', '٢ ٢ ٠٢ شباط فبراير شباط فبراير'],
['M Mo MM MMMM MMM', '٢ ٢ ٠٢ فبراير فبراير'],
['YYYY YY', '٢٠١٠ ١٠'],
['D Do DD', '١٤ ١٤ ١٤'],
['d do dddd ddd dd', '٠ ٠ الأحد أحد ح'],
Expand All @@ -53,13 +53,13 @@ test('format', function (assert) {
['LT', '١٥:٢٥'],
['LTS', '١٥:٢٥:٥٠'],
['L', '١٤/\u200f٢/\u200f٢٠١٠'],
['LL', '١٤ شباط فبراير ٢٠١٠'],
['LLL', '١٤ شباط فبراير ٢٠١٠ ١٥:٢٥'],
['LLLL', 'الأحد ١٤ شباط فبراير ٢٠١٠ ١٥:٢٥'],
['LL', '١٤ فبراير ٢٠١٠'],
['LLL', '١٤ فبراير ٢٠١٠ ١٥:٢٥'],
['LLLL', 'الأحد ١٤ فبراير ٢٠١٠ ١٥:٢٥'],
['l', '١٤/\u200f٢/\u200f٢٠١٠'],
['ll', '١٤ شباط فبراير ٢٠١٠'],
['lll', '١٤ شباط فبراير ٢٠١٠ ١٥:٢٥'],
['llll', 'أحد ١٤ شباط فبراير ٢٠١٠ ١٥:٢٥']
['ll', '١٤ فبراير ٢٠١٠'],
['lll', '١٤ فبراير ٢٠١٠ ١٥:٢٥'],
['llll', 'أحد ١٤ فبراير ٢٠١٠ ١٥:٢٥']
],
b = moment(new Date(2010, 1, 14, 15, 25, 50, 125)),
i;
Expand Down